Popular Post winterwheel Posted June 7, 2023 Popular Post Share Posted June 7, 2023 I rode out in the evening to grab a takeaway coffee from a fast-food place. At that time of the day it is very quiet, no line so I leaned it up against the outside of the building by the door. I was in for for 3-5 minutes, came out it was gone. I believe there was a car in the parking lot that had some people in it; my thought is that as soon as I went inside they grabbed it and drove off. I learned from that to always walk the wheel into the store with me; I've never had a complaint from stores about doing that. 4 1 2 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Dan Cobar Posted February 26 Share Posted February 26 7 hours ago, DavidB said: Some years ago Kingsong remotely bricked Chinese market wheels sold internationally. I guess if you contact them they can make it unusable to the thief but of course that doesn't get your wheel back and may lead to it being trashed. Besides the problems already stated, It would have to be connected to the KS app for that to happen. Not likely to happen while the thief has it. Some(all? most?) wheels can have a password set. This would be a pain in the ass, but if you were in a high crime area, might be worth doing. It also helps if we are careful to not buy used wheels that have a price that is too good to be true. Or don't come with the stock charger or box. If word gets out that they have no re-sale value, it will reduce the incentive to steal them. 1 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Gordo63 Posted April 19 Share Posted April 19 Maybe the euc applications like euc world or the manufacture apps of each brand would have a section where you could advise them if your wheel was stolen. If the thief stole it would use the app the wheel would get lock out . Also buyers of used euc could ask the seller for the serial number and check if it's stolen. I would not buy a used euc without seeing the orignal purchase document . When I sold mine I had the document and give it to the person so if they resell it they can prove it did not fall off a truck . 3 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
